Output 152a8630501c2e1bf5ec2995ea698e4cc726fda0cc532b3b21affac858e4ef3e:3

value
12273939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ce41d08df084f88466ad2277985364f0e72e5bff OP_EQUAL
address
3LVbxwhmVqytmZbYzkRyCoNfb9R8wUZVRz
transaction
152a8630501c2e1bf5ec2995ea698e4cc726fda0cc532b3b21affac858e4ef3e
spent
true